Lot Essay
In 1992, to commemorate the 20th anniversary of the Royal Oak, Audemars Piguet launched an extremely rarefied series of timepieces with salmon dial - a first for this color dial within the Royal oak family. In the early 2000, Audemars Piguet reintroduced the coveted and enticing salmon dial in two models, a platinum perpetual calendar and a white gold chronograph like the present timepiece.
The beauty of the salmon coloured dial and 39 mm. diam. white gold case is hard to beat and is certainly one of the most successful and covetable colour combinations ever produced for the Royal Oak range.
